Commercial lawn mowing services involve the professional maintenance of large or complex outdoor spaces, including the regular trimming, cutting, and edging of grass on commercial properties such as office parks, retail centers, and industrial sites. These services are designed to keep expansive lawns neat, healthy, and visually appealing, often requiring specialized equipment and experienced crews to handle the scale and specific landscape requirements. By entrusting this work to experienced contractors, property managers and business owners can ensure their grounds remain well-maintained without the need to allocate internal resources or manage ongoing lawn care tasks.

Many property owners turn to commercial lawn mowing services to address common problems like overgrown grass, uneven mowing, and weed growth that can detract from a property's professional appearance. Overgrown lawns can also attract pests or create safety hazards, especially in high-traffic areas. Regular mowing helps prevent these issues by maintaining a uniform look and promoting healthy grass growth. Additionally, professional landscapers can identify potential problems early, such as soil compaction or pest activity, and provide advice or treatment options to keep the grounds in optimal condition.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Lawn Mowing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Langley,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Residential Lawns - Many local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for routine lawn mowing of small to medium-sized residential properties in the Langley area. Most projects fall within this range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end for additional services or larger yards.

Medium-sized Commercial Properties - For larger commercial lawns or properties requiring regular maintenance, costs typically range from $600 to $1,200 per visit. These projects often involve more equipment and labor, which can influence the final price.

Large or Complex Landscaping - Larger or more intricate lawn care projects, such as extensive landscaping or multi-acre properties, can range from $1,200 to $3,500 or more. Many contractors handle these jobs, but prices vary depending on scope and complexity.

Full Lawn Replacement - Complete overhaul or replacement of a lawn, including soil preparation and new turf installation, can cost $3,500 to over $5,000. Such projects are less common and tend to fall into the higher end of the pricing spectrum.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ating commercial lawn mowing service providers in the Langley, WA area,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how long a contractor has been working in the local market and whether they have a track record of handling commercial properties comparable in size and complexity. An experienced service provider will typically have a better understanding of the unique landscaping needs specific to the area, which can contribute to more consistent and reliable results.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ors. Homeowners should seek detailed descriptions of the scope of work, including mowing frequency, edging, trimming, and cleanup procedures.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the services provided. It’s also helpful to review any agreements or proposals carefully to confirm that they specify the work to be performed and any other relevant details.

Reputable references and effective communication are key indicators of a dependable service provider. Homeowners can ask local contractors for references from past clients with similar properties to gain insight into their professionalism and quality of work. Good communication-whether through phone, email, or in-person interactions-also plays a crucial role in establishing a positive working relationship. When comparing options, it’s beneficial to choose service providers who respond promptly and clearly to questions, demonstrating their commitment to client satisfaction and transparency.
